Sony has raised the prices of its PlayStation Plus subscription service across more than 20 countries. The price hikes include increases in Canada, Australia, and Latin America, now making subscriptions especially pricey without the addition of new features. Canadian subscribers now see significant increases across all three tiers, with the highest reaching over $200. This trend follows recent PS5 console price hikes, highlighting a growing cost barrier facing players in these regions. The increases raise concerns about affordability and access to gaming amidst ongoing economic challenges influenced by tariffs and global market conditions.
